The New Mexico Community Foundation is now accepting applications for the First American Bank Scholarship, a four-year scholarship established in 2012 for graduates of Chaparral High School in Chaparral, New Mexico. Each year, NMCF selects 20 recipients to receive scholarship awards ranging from $500 to $3,000 per semester, for up to eight semesters of college. Deadline April 7, 2017 at 5pm.
The New Mexico Community Foundation is also accepting applications for the Jonathan Sherman Spradling Memorial Scholarship. This scholarship was established in 2005 in memory of Artesia High School graduate Jonathan Spradling. NMCF awards four $1,000 scholarships to a graduating senior from each of the following high schools: Artesia, Belen, Los Lunas and Valencia. Deadline April 7, 2017 at 5pm.
